先决条件
- 查询帮助 (
.qhelp) 文件必须附带具有相同基名称的查询 (.ql) 文件。 - 查询帮助文件应遵循查询帮助文档的标准结构和样式。 有关详细信息,请参阅 CodeQL 存储库中的查询帮助样式指南。
预览您的查询帮助文档
-
若要将查询帮助文件呈现为 Markdown,请运行以下命令:
Shell codeql generate query-help <qhelp|query|dir|suite> --format=markdown [--output=<dir|file>]
codeql generate query-help <qhelp|query|dir|suite> --format=markdown [--output=<dir|file>]有关可用于此命令的选项的信息,请参阅 生成查询帮助。
-
如果收到任何警告消息,请查看并修复它们,然后重新运行命令。 默认情况下,CodeQL CLI 将在以下情况下显示警告消息:
- 任何查询帮助都无效
- 命令中指定的任何
.qhelp文件都不具有与随附.ql文件相同的基名称 - 命令中指定的任何
.ql文件都不具有与随附.qhelp文件相同的基名称
-
查看输出目录、文件或终端中呈现的 Markdown,检查文件是否按预期显示。
延伸阅读
-
[查询帮助文件](https://codeql.github.com/docs/writing-codeql-queries/query-help-files/#query-help-files) -
[AUTOTITLE](/code-security/codeql-cli/codeql-cli-manual/generate-query-help)